The Kenya
National rugby under-20’s side Chipu have started National trials at the KCB
Sports club, Ruaraka in Nairobi ahead of the Barthes Cup.

According to
Chipu’s team manager Peter Mutai, the team is targeting to recruit players with
particular interest in various positions.

For the
front row position, only players born between July 2004 and July 2005 while for
Non-Front row positions, only players born between July 2005 and July 2006 will
be eligible to audition.

The technical
team will settle on a total of 36 players who are going to be in camp in
preparation for the tournament that will be held later in April.

Interested
players had earlier been asked to steer clear of Marijuana and Kathine that is
commonly found in Khat, drugs often abused by youths here in the country.
